Barbecue sauce vs. Cocktail sauce

Side-by-side comparison of nutrient values per 100g edible portion, sourced directly from the U.S. Department of Agriculture's FoodData Central (FDC) - SR Legacy reference foods and FDC Foundation foods (April 2026 release). Each value reflects USDA's standardized laboratory analysis methodology under USDA data-documentation methodology.

Cocktail sauce has the most protein of the foods compared, at 1.4 g per 100g.

Nutrient Barbecue sauce Cocktail sauce
Protein 0.82 G1.4 G
Total lipid (fat) 0.63 G1.1 G
Carbohydrate, by difference 40.8 G28.2 G
Energy 172 KCAL128 KCAL
Total Sugars 33.2 G11.8 G
Fiber, total dietary 0.9 G1.8 G
Calcium, Ca 33 MG26 MG
Iron, Fe 0.64 MG0.83 MG
Potassium, K 232 MG309 MG
Sodium, Na 1027 MG1262 MG
Cholesterol 0 MG0 MG
Fatty acids, total saturated 0.04 G0 G
